Lee Evans Due A Serious Bonus; Will Bills Pay?
(3/28 10:28 PT)

The Facts:
Evans, who has been one of the NFL’s best deep threats since being selected in the first round of the 2004 NFL Draft by the Bills, is due a $1.5 million roster bonus on the fifth day of the new league year, a source confirmed. Evans, 30, is due $3.275 million in base salary for 2011. Reported by FOXSports.com

Fantasy Football Diehards Line:
According to FOXSports.com's Adam Caplan, paying Evans his roster bonus seems like it would be a no-brainer considering he participated in roughly 77 percent of the offensive snaps, but HC Chan Gailey would like to see more versatility to Evans’ game. “I think we have to wait and see how it falls,” Gailey said during last week’s NFL owners meetings. “I’m hoping that we can really get Lee consistent running routes and consistent at doing a lot of things. He’s been more of a deep threat. I’ve got to get him to do a better job of becoming an underneath threat. I’ve got to do a better job of that. ...” While Stevie Johnson's emergence as a legitimate threat, Evans' ability to adjust to changing role -- at 30 -- is certainly worth questioning. It'll be interesting to see how the Bills play this one. Stay tuned.
